Getting to know the rules of poker is an essential first step for any beginner. Here are some of the basics:

There are 2 mandatory bets (called blinds) that each player puts into the pot before any other action occurs in a hand. Once all players have received their 2 hole cards, another round of betting starts. The first player to the left of the dealer places his or her chips into the pot, and then each active player must raise his or her stake equal to that of the last raising player or risk losing all his or her chips.
